Choosing the right materials for refrigerator door panel die production is crucial. Various materials can influence the final product's durability and aesthetic appeal. Common options include metal, plastic, and composite materials. Each has its own pros and cons.
Metal offers high strength and a premium look. However, it can be heavier and more expensive. Plastic, on the other hand, is lightweight and cost-effective. It provides flexibility in design but might lack the robust feel of metal. Composite materials combine the best of both worlds, but they can be tricky to work with.
It’s essential to consider the intended use. Will the panels face harsh conditions or occasional wear? This decision influences the longevity of the product. Overlooking this aspect may lead to regrets later. Conducting tests on sample materials can help in making an informed choice. Remember, each option may require unique treatment during production.

Maintaining refrigerator door panel dies is crucial for ensuring longevity and efficiency. Regular inspections can reveal issues before they become serious. Look for signs of wear, such as cracks or misalignments. Addressing these minor problems early can save time and costs later.
Utilize proper cleaning methods to keep the dies in optimal condition. A mixture of mild detergent and water works well. Avoid harsh chemicals that might damage the surface. After cleaning, ensure the die is thoroughly dried to prevent rust. This step is often overlooked but critical for maintaining durability.
Additionally, consider the storage environment. Humidity and temperature fluctuations can negatively impact the dies. Storing them in a controlled area helps prevent deterioration. Frequent usage should also be tracked, as overuse may lead to quicker wear. It’s essential to reflect on your operating practices to improve maintenance strategies continually.
